The research was based on records from the period 1985–2014 from the Institute of Meteorology and Water Management, and more detailed archived meteorological data from the period 2004–2014 from the station in Kalisz. The study identified no clear trend in the number of days with thunderstorms during the study period, except a slight increase of the thunderstorm occurrence frequency. Thunderstorms form during the whole year and all day long. However, the warm part of the year is connected with the highest thunderstorm activity in Kalisz, as well as the warmest part of the day. They appear most frequently between 15.01 and 16.00. The majority of thunderstorms last for only 11–20 minutes. The longest storm was observed on September 17th, 2010 (361 min.).
